General match analysis
Valur holds a slight home advantage: at home they score 1.83 goals per match and record xG 1.66, while Keflavík average 1.8 goals away with xG 1.49. Both teams have weak defenses — Valur concedes 2.33 goals at home on average (xG against 2.28), and Keflavík concede 2.8 goals away (xG against 1.79), which points to a high-scoring game. In the last five matches Valur scored 6 goals and average 1.2 points per game (2 wins, 3 losses), while Keflavík scored 7 goals and average 1.4 points per game (2 wins, 1 draw, 2 losses), so the visitors are marginally better in form. Valur, however, sit higher in the table (6th vs 8th) and have a higher home win rate (50% vs Keflavík’s 40% away wins), as well as a greater share of clean sheets at home (17% vs 0%), providing organizational advantage. Considering similar efficiency metrics (conversion 13% vs 14% and average shots on target 4.67 vs 4.8) and both teams’ vulnerability to conceding, I project a Valur win, but expect an open match with several goals.
